Output f596ba29f11683f91e68c9996c99fb3ff87c0034aae6b7a4e95713722f921d34:56

value
593390
script pubkey
OP_0 OP_PUSHBYTES_20 93f5f6008c1a00aa40199400b445f19c7db680ec
address
bc1qj06lvqyvrgq25sqejsqtg303n37mdq8vkac2y0
transaction
f596ba29f11683f91e68c9996c99fb3ff87c0034aae6b7a4e95713722f921d34
spent
true